National Leadership and Skills Conference (NLSC)

June 1-6, 2026

Atlanta, Georgia



NLSC will be held EARLY THIS YEAR due to the FIFA World Cup which takes over the city in mid-to-late June. As such, the deadlines are also earlier this year. We plan to have the registration information posted on the website prior to the State Conference, so you can budget and talk to your students early.

Holiday Schedule for SkillsUSA Absorb and Educational Resource Stores

SkillsUSA will be closed for winter break from Monday, December 22, through Friday, January 2. Absorb (Career Essentials) and Educational Resource stores will also be closed during this period.



Please submit any educational resource orders before 5 p.m. ET on Thursday, December 18, to ensure they ship in December. Orders received after 5 p.m. ET on December 18 will be shipped the week of January 5. If you have questions or need help, our Customer Care Team is available at 844-875-4557 or [email protected].

New Scholarship Opportunity for SkillsUSA Members
SkillsUSA is proud to partner with the SkillPointe Foundation to expand scholarship access for students pursuing careers in Construction, Energy, Manufacturing, Transportation, Healthcare, Automotive and more.

The SkillPointe Foundation has committed $250,000 exclusively for SkillsUSA members, giving them top consideration across dozens of high-demand career scholarships. Visit the SkillPointe Foundation's website to explore current opportunities and apply.
